Understanding Risotto: The Heart of Italian Cuisine
Risotto is more than just a dish; it’s a symbol of Italian culinary tradition. Characterized by its creamy texture and rich flavor, this rice dish has earned its place on tables around the world.
The secret lies in the choice of rice. Arborio rice, known for its high starch content, is the star of the show. When cooked slowly in broth, it releases starches that create a velvety consistency, perfect for a hearty risotto.
This preparation method allows each grain to absorb the flavors, making each bite a delightful experience.

Cooking Techniques for Risotto Perfection
Crafting a perfect risotto may seem daunting, but mastering a few techniques makes all the difference. The process requires patience and attention, as each step lays the foundation for the final dish.
Start by sautéing the onions and garlic until fragrant; this sets the stage for aromatic depth. Gradually adding warm broth ensures even cooking and allows the rice to absorb flavors without becoming mushy.
Stirring frequently is key—this motion helps release more starch from the rice, leading to that signature creamy texture we all love.

Delicious Garlic Shrimp Risotto

This risotto features tender shrimp sautéed with garlic and finished with creamy Parmesan cheese, creating a rich and flavorful dish. It takes about 30-40 minutes to prepare and serves 4 people.
Ingredients
- 1 cup Arborio rice
- 1 lb large shrimp, peeled and deveined
- 4 cups chicken or vegetable broth
- 1 cup dry white wine
- 1 medium onion, finely chopped
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 tablespoons butter
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- Chopped parsley for garnish
Instructions
- Heat the Broth: In a saucepan, heat the broth and keep it warm over low heat.
- Sauté Aromatics: In a large skillet, heat the olive oil and 1 tablespoon of butter over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and garlic; sauté until the onion is transl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
- Cook the Shrimp: Add the shrimp to the skillet and cook until they turn pink, about 3-4 minutes. Remove the shrimp and set aside.
- Add the Rice: Stir in the Arborio rice and cook for 1-2 minutes, until slightly toasted. Pour in the white wine and stir until it is mostly absorbed by the rice.
- Add the Broth Gradually: Begin adding the warm broth, one ladle at a time, allowing the rice to absorb the liquid before adding more. Stir frequently for about 18-20 minutes, or until the rice is al dente.
- Finish with Creaminess: Once the rice is cooked, stir in the remaining butter and grated Parmesan. Add the shrimp back to the skillet, mixing to combine.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
- Serve: Transfer to serving plates and garnish with chopped parsley. Enjoy your creamy garlic shrimp risotto hot.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 40 minutes
